Bayern were close to their first defeat in the Bundesliga 2024/25 today

Bayern were close to their first defeat in the 2024/25 Bundesliga. In the away game against Borussia Dortmund, the Munich club were behind after the 27th minute goal by Jamie Bynoe-Gittens and could only save themselves in the end of the game when substitute Oliseh crossed to Musiala, who headed the ball into the corner from the centre of the penalty area - 1-1.

We would like to remind you that Bayern will be Shakhtar's next opponents in the Champions League. The game between the Miners and the Bundesliga leaders will take place in Gelsenkirchen on December 10th.

Borussia D - Bayern 1:1 (1:0)
Goals: Bynoe-Gittens, 27 (1:0); Musiala, 85 (1:1)

Borussia D: Kobel; Anton (Süle, 18); Schlotterbeck N.; Bensebaini; Ryerson (Couto, 74); Nmecha F.; Groß; Sabitzer (Reyna G., 90); Bynoe-Gittens (Malen, 74); Guirassy; Beier M.
Bench: Meyer A.; Kabar; Azhil; Duranville; Campbell C.
Yellow Cards: Ryerson 71; Beier M. 90

Bayern: Neuer; Upamecano; Kim Min-jae (Olise, 80); Kimmich; Goretzka; Sane L.; Davies; Laimer (Boey, 62); Musiala; Kane (Muller, 33); Tel M. (Coman, 62)
Bench: Peretz Da.; Dier; Guerreiro; Aznou; Ibrahimovic A.
Yellow Cards: Sane L. 88; Upamecano 90
